    About Albena

    Albena, a name gracefully rooted in the Latin for "lime tree" or "linden tree," carries a distinctly earthy and feminine charm. Evoking images of fragrant blossoms and serene natural beauty, it offers a classic feel without being overly common in Western spheres. This name is a wonderful choice for parents who appreciate a sense of grounded elegance and a connection to nature, but also desire a name with a subtle international flair. Popular in Bulgaria, Albena stands out as a unique yet universally appealing option, offering a gentle strength that feels both timeless and fresh for a contemporary child.

    Famous People Named Albena

    • Albena Denkova (Bulgarian ice dancer)
    • Albena Pavlova (Bulgarian actress)
    • Albena Veskova (Bulgarian singer)
